| Summary: | In the paper entitled “The Properties of a New Subclass of Harmonic Univalent Mappings” [1], the presentation of Lemma 9 and Theorem 10 (in Section 3) is taken from that of Lemma 3.1 and Theorem 3.2 of Muir paper’s “S. Muir, “Harmonic mappings convex in one or every direction,” Computational Methods and Function Theory, vol. 12, no. 1, pp. 221–239, 2012”. |
